How many inches of fence will be needed to fence the parallelogram-shaped 198.3 inches by 87.4 inches

Respuesta :

chisnau chisnau
  • 04-11-2018

Sides of parallelogram are = 198.30 inches and 87.4 inches

To know the length of fence needed to fence the parallelogram, we will find the perimeter of the parallelogram.

Perimeter = 2(a+b) where a and b are the sides of the parallelogram

[tex]P=2(198.30+87.40)[/tex]

P=571.40 inches

Hence, 571.40 inches of fence is needed.
